What is a temporary parttime?

Temporary part-time jobs are positions where employees work fewer hours than full-time staff and are hired for a limited period. These roles can last from a few days to several months and are often used to fill gaps during busy seasons, cover employee absences, or complete short-term projects. Temporary part-time jobs offer flexibility for both employers and workers, making them ideal for students, retirees, or anyone seeking supplemental income. They can be found in various industries, including retail, hospitality, administration, and healthcare.

KIDSPACE LIBRARY CLERK II PT
Windsor Public Library
(Part-time)

The Windsor Public Library is seeking two knowledgeable, tech-savvy part-time Library Clerks with a strong commitment to serving children and their caregivers to join our Kidspace team. This position provides direct public service in a busy childrens library environment and supports daily Kidspace operations.

What Youll Do:
Provide reference, readers advisory, and computer assistance at the Kidspace service desk
Assist children and caregivers with locating materials and using library resources
Shelve and shelf-read library materials to ensure accurate organization
Support literacy-focused services and programs
Complete additional projects and tasks as assigned

Our Ideal Candidate Will Possess:
Enthusiasm and passion for literacy and library service
Strong customer service skills and the ability to work effectively with children and families
Team-oriented mindset with motivation and organizational skills
Effective oral and written communication skills with diverse customers and coworkers
Patience, flexibility, attention to detail, and ability to work in a fast-paced environment
Comfort working with computers, technology, and social media

Minimum Requirements:
High School diploma or equivalent
One (1) or more years of library experience working with children preferred
Proficiency in MS Office Suite (Word, Excel, Internet) and other programs as needed
Familiarity with Innovative Interfaces ILS, Excel, and Publisher a plus

Compensation and Schedule:
Hourly pay rate: $19.06 per hour
Schedule:

  • Regular Hours: two Sundays a month, Tuesdays 10am-3pm, and two Saturdays a month 1:30pm5pm
  • Additional temporary hours required from September thru December 2026: Wednesdays 1:30pm5pm, Thursdays 1pm-4pm, and Fridays 10am-1:30pm
